How to Choose the Right Kuttipencil


Choosing the right Kuttipencil may seem simple, but there are several factors to consider. When selecting a Kuttipencil for children, it’s important to choose one that is easy to grip, lightweight, and made from non-toxic materials. For artists and professionals, the quality of the graphite, the durability of the pencil, and the ability to create fine lines are crucial factors. Kuttipencil comes in a variety of hardness levels, with softer pencils ideal for shading and harder pencils suited for precise lines.
